Z83.42 is a billable ICD-10-CM diagnosis code for family history of familial hypercholesterolemia. It is valid on HIPAA claims for fiscal year 2026 (October 1, 2025 through September 30, 2026). The code is not accepted as a principal diagnosis by the Medicare Code Editor and exempt from POA reporting. In AHRQ's Clinical Classifications Software (CCSR), this diagnosis falls under Family history of disease.

Code EditsBilling

Medicare Code Editor checks that affect claim validity for Z83.42.

There are selected codes that describe a circumstance which influences an individual's health status but not a current illness or injury, or codes that are not specific manifestations but may be due to an underlying cause. These codes are considered unacceptable as a principal diagnosis.

Present on Admission (POA)Billing

Z83.42 is exempt from POA reporting on inpatient claims to general acute care hospitals. Review other POA exempt codes.

Cholesterol

Cholesterol is a waxy, fat-like substance that's found in all the cells in your body. Your body needs some cholesterol to make hormones, vitamin D, and substances that help you digest foods. Your body makes all the cholesterol it needs. Cholesterol is also found in foods from animal sources, such as egg yolks, meat, and cheese.

Questions About Z83.42Overview

Is Z83.42 a billable code?

Yes. This is a billable ICD-10-CM code, specific enough to report family history of familial hypercholesterolemia on HIPAA-covered claims from October 1, 2025 through September 30, 2026.

Can Z83.42 be a principal diagnosis?

No. The Medicare Code Editor rejects this code as a principal diagnosis because family history of familial hypercholesterolemia describes a circumstance that influences health status rather than a current illness. Report it as a secondary diagnosis.

Is Z83.42 exempt from POA reporting?

Yes. CMS lists this code among those exempt from present on admission reporting, so hospitals do not assign a POA indicator for family history of familial hypercholesterolemia on inpatient claims.

What is the ICD-9 equivalent of Z83.42?

Under the General Equivalence Mappings, family history of familial hypercholesterolemia converts to ICD-9-CM V18.19 (fm hx endo/metab dis NEC). The mapping is approximate, so confirm the match fits the documentation.
